Webb6 okt. 2024 · Step 1. Start by cleaning the surface before you begin to paint kitchen cabinets. No matter which paint you use, latex, chalk, or mineral paint, it’s important to start by cleaning the cabinets with TSP. This is a cleaning product that is available at any hardware store. TSP removes any grease or residue. Webb24 maj 2024 · Step 1 (Sanding Cabinets) Most stained wood cabinets are top-coated with polyurethane or other urethane enamels. Woodgrain orientation and the amount of polyurethane (or other enamels) will determine how much sanding is needed. Typically, oak has a deeper grain orientation and requires more sanding.
WebbMake sure you’ve masked off areas in the kitchen you don’t want to get paint on. Apply bond coat with a 2″ synthetic brush in the direction of the grain. (Make sure to smooth out any drips on edges before they dry.) Apply bond coat to cabinet frames. Let the bond coat dry for 2 hours. Apply second coat and let dry for about 2 hours. Webb23 sep. 2024 · Place your cabinet doors and drawer fronts on tripods and wait until the first side is dry before flipping them over and painting the other side. Make sure you lay off the paint. In other words, go back to the side you started on and apply a series of even roller strokes to remove the tool marks and make everything look uniform.
